summaryrefslogtreecommitdiffstats
path: root/Mac/Tools
diff options
context:
space:
mode:
authorJust van Rossum <just@lettererror.com>1999-02-25 22:33:05 (GMT)
committerJust van Rossum <just@lettererror.com>1999-02-25 22:33:05 (GMT)
commit68922f06bf8fecc15c16e911f5f0a58ec6eabc18 (patch)
tree791566f7b05f1daf55843383df4a3cfc92c47e7d /Mac/Tools
parentcf2efc67d93a8fe6b7820b2a99bd20cc89c2ed73 (diff)
downloadcpython-68922f06bf8fecc15c16e911f5f0a58ec6eabc18.zip
cpython-68922f06bf8fecc15c16e911f5f0a58ec6eabc18.tar.gz
cpython-68922f06bf8fecc15c16e911f5f0a58ec6eabc18.tar.bz2
fixed "crashing" bug when scripts folder as stored in prefs file does not exist.
Diffstat (limited to 'Mac/Tools')
-rw-r--r--Mac/Tools/IDE/PythonIDEMain.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/Mac/Tools/IDE/PythonIDEMain.py b/Mac/Tools/IDE/PythonIDEMain.py
index 545c09b..3501971 100644
--- a/Mac/Tools/IDE/PythonIDEMain.py
+++ b/Mac/Tools/IDE/PythonIDEMain.py
@@ -90,6 +90,7 @@ class PythonIDE(Wapplication.Application):
prefs = self.getprefs()
try:
fss, fss_changed = macfs.RawAlias(prefs.scriptsfolder).Resolve()
+ self.scriptsfolder = fss.NewAlias()
except:
path = os.path.join(os.getcwd(), 'Scripts')
if not os.path.exists(path):
@@ -98,7 +99,6 @@ class PythonIDE(Wapplication.Application):
self.scriptsfolder = fss.NewAlias()
self.scriptsfoldermodtime = fss.GetDates()[1]
else:
- self.scriptsfolder = fss.NewAlias()
self.scriptsfoldermodtime = fss.GetDates()[1]
prefs.scriptsfolder = self.scriptsfolder.data
self._scripts = {}